Transaction 5640228aa63544c04182d712b2005278fc873ad8c2320a6e9a9857e18d1fab38
1 Input
1 Output
-
5640228aa63544c04182d712b2005278fc873ad8c2320a6e9a9857e18d1fab38:0
- value
- 995306
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ce5c876c90cf060e6c4ace5c4f24c1ac14fee4c8 OP_EQUAL
- address
- 3LW9y65sY5jqjKc3i8W9CBVWNc3P89xEsw